Plant elimination is an crucial practice for keeping healthy landscapes, managing overgrowth, and preparing areas for new plantings or hardscape installations. This procedure includes getting rid of weeds, shrubs, little trees, or intrusive types, taking care to extract roots to prevent regrowth. Correct methods prevent damage to surrounding plants and soil structure. Mechanical elimination, hand digging, or chemical treatments may be used depending on plant type and site conditions. Post-removal, soil amendment and grading make sure that the location appropriates for replanting, yard installation, or other landscape improvements. Routine plant elimination supports landscape visual appeals, minimizes pest and illness pressures, and improves general plant health. Properly managed elimination prepares the home for sustainable and aesthetically enticing outside environments
